Slice the leek, including the green part. Peel the potatoes then cut them into cubes. Chop the broccoli stalk into chunks and tear the florets apart.
Heat the oil in a pan, then then gently sauté the leek for 5 minutes, then add the garlic and cook for another 3 minutes. Add the potatoes and broccoli stalk pieces. Sauté (under cover) for another 5 minutes, then add the stock and broccoli florets.
Bring to the boil and cook for about 15 minutes, until the vegetables are tender.
Turn off the heat. Add the parsley leaves and, using a stick blender, purée the soup until smooth and silky.
Serve it with freshly ground pepper and a small spoonful of apple cider vinegar.
